在现代互联网时代,网页渲染作为用户体验的重要组成部分,直接决定了我们对网站的印象及使用满意度。然而,许多人并未真正了解背后复杂的光栅化过程。光栅化是将矢量图形转化为光栅图像的过程,是网页渲染的一个关键环节。本文将深入探讨这一过程及其所蕴含的艺术之美。

在网页渲染中,用户所见的每一个元素,实际上都是由代码描述的图形。这些图形最初都是以矢量的方式存在,包含了丰富的数学信息,比如线条的起始和终止点、曲线的形状等。而光栅化则是将这些矢量描述转换为像素网格的过程。每一个像素代表着屏幕上的一个点,光栅化过程通过将这些点填充颜色,最终形成了我们所看到的图像。可以说,光栅化不仅是一个技术过程,更是一种创作艺术,其间包含着对色彩、形状与空间的深刻理解。

深入探讨浏览器的光栅化过程与网页渲染的艺术之美

光栅化的过程可以分为多个步骤。首先,浏览器会解析HTML和CSS代码,生成DOM(文档对象模型)和CSSOM(CSS对象模型)。接着,浏览器将这两者组合成一个渲染树,该树是页面的视觉表现结构。随后,光栅化过程通过计算渲染树上每个节点的几何信息,逐步构建出最终的像素图像。这一过程不仅需要高效的算法支持,还需要强大的并行计算能力,以确保在高分辨率屏幕上的流畅表现。

值得一提的是,光栅化的艺术之美在于其创造性。在这个过程中,设计师通过颜色、形状和层次感的巧妙搭配,创造出了视觉享受。当光栅化有效地转换了这些符号信息为独特的图像时,便达到了将艺术与科技的紧密结合。比如,网页设计师会通过渐变色、阴影和透明度等效果,赋予网页生命感,使用户在浏览时体验到视觉的愉悦。

此外,随着技术的进步,现代浏览器不断优化光栅化流程,使其更加高效和灵活。例如,使用GPU(图形处理单元)而非CPU(中央处理单元)进行光栅化,极大提升了渲染速度和质量。同时,一些新兴技术,如WebGL和Canvas,使得网页图形渲染的可能性倍增,设计师可以在网页上实现更为复杂和动感的视觉效果。这样的技术创新不仅提升了用户的视觉体验,也极大丰富了设计师的创作工具。

总的来说,光栅化过程是网页渲染中不可或缺的一部分,承载着技术与艺术的结合。它不是简单的图像转换,而是一个充满创造力的过程,反映了设计师的想法和技艺。理解光栅化不仅能让我们更好地欣赏网页设计的美,也能促使我们在未来的数字艺术创作中,探索更为广阔的可能性。